DUBAI: Iran needs stronger guarantees from Washington for the revival of a 2015 nuclear deal, its foreign minister said in Moscow on Wednesday , adding that the UN atomic watchdog should drop its"politically motivated probes" of Tehran's nuclear work.
"Iran is carefully reviewing the EU-drafted text ... We need stronger guarantees from the other party to have a sustainable deal," Amirabdollahian told a joint news conference with his Russian counterpart in Moscow. White House national security spokesman John Kirby said he had not seen the Iranian foreign minister's comments.
Biden told Israeli Prime Minister Yair Lapid in a phone call on Wednesday the United States will never allow Iran to acquire a nuclear weapon, the White House said in a statement. The man who ultimately matters in Iran's nuclear dispute with the West, Supreme Leader Ayatollah Ali Khamenei, has not commented on the nuclear talks in his public speeches for months.
"It will be a massive embarrassment for the supreme leader if Washington pulls out of the deal again," said a former Iranian official."That is one of the reasons behind Tehran's insistence on this issue."
